Corleone is located between the Rocca Sottana and the Soprana, on top of the Saracen tower, and has a rich architectural heritage especially in the historic center. The town, due to the very numerous presence of religious buildings, has been named “the town of a hundred churches”; among the most famous are the Capuchin Convent, the Monastery of the Most Holy Savior, the Church of Sant’Agostino and that of San Domenico. The answer given by the municipality of Corleone after having been the bulwark of many mafia gangs is certainly worth underlining; in fact the country has acquired the title of "World Capital of Legality" by virtue of the numerous social campaigns against crime.

The farm, which covers an area of ​​about 1 hectare, is organic, with fruit and vegetable crops, cereals and legumes. The organic method of cultivation bans treatments with synthetic chemicals and favors all those practices that are aimed primarily at preventing diseases and attacks by harmful insects and then a series of treatments based on natural products (such as algae, etc.)
